Sourcing guidance for Grating Stair

How to choose the right material and surface treatment for Grating Stairs?

Selecting the material depends heavily on the installation environment. For industrial settings with high humidity or outdoor exposure, Hot-Dip Galvanized Steel (ISO 1461) is the industry standard due to its superior corrosion resistance. For highly corrosive chemical plants or marine environments, Stainless Steel (304 or 316L) or Fiberglass Reinforced Plastic (FRP) is recommended. Ensure the zinc coating thickness is at least 70-85 microns to guarantee a service life of over 20 years.

What are the key safety specifications and compliance standards for stair treads?

Safety is paramount in B2B procurement. Treads must comply with ISO 14122-3 or ANSI A1264.1 standards. A critical feature is the Anti-slip Nosing (checkered plate, serrated bar, or abrasive grit), which must be clearly visible and provide high friction. The mesh size (pitch) should be small enough to prevent tools from falling through (typically 30mm x 100mm or 40mm x 100mm) while allowing for light and air passage.

How do I determine the correct load-bearing capacity and dimensions?

You must specify the Maximum Allowable Span and the Concentrated Load requirements (usually 1.5kN over a 100mm x 100mm area for industrial use). Common bearing bar sizes range from 25x3mm to 50x5mm. Always request a Load Table from the supplier to ensure the grating won't deflect more than 1/200th of the span under maximum load to prevent worker fatigue and structural failure.

What are the different installation methods for Grating Stairs?

There are two primary types: Welded Connection and Bolted Connection. Bolted treads are preferred for maintenance as they are easy to replace and require End Plates with pre-drilled holes. Welded treads offer a more permanent, rigid structure but damage the galvanized coating during installation, requiring cold-galvanizing spray touch-ups to prevent rust.

Cross-Border Procurement Considerations for Grating Stairs

How can I mitigate quality risks when sourcing from overseas suppliers?

Request a Material Test Certificate (MTC) for every batch to verify steel grade and chemical composition. For large orders, hire a third-party inspector (like SGS or Intertek) to perform a Zinc Coating Thickness Test and a Load Deflection Test before the balance payment is made. What are the logistics and packaging precautions for heavy steel products?

Grating stairs are heavy and prone to surface scratching. Insist on Steel Palletizing with Plastic Film Wrapping and Steel Strapping to prevent shifting during sea freight. Ensure the supplier provides a detailed Packing List that matches the markings on each bundle to facilitate fast customs clearance and organized on-site assembly.

How should I negotiate pricing and MOQs for customized grating?

Pricing is usually calculated by weight (USD/Ton) or piece (USD/Unit). For customized sizes, the waste rate of raw materials affects the price; try to standardize dimensions to match the supplier's master sheet sizes (e.g., 1m x 6m) to reduce costs. Bulk discounts of 5-10% are common for full container loads (FCL) due to optimized shipping costs.
